Game two of the Chicago Blackhawks versus Vancouver Canucks series starts tonight, and after a spanking in the first game, the Hawks must push back and win this game two at home. A loss tonight would certainly be the Hawks' undoing as I don't see them going into Vancouver and winning both games. Even if they win one in Vancouver they'll still be down 3-1, and Vancouver is too good of a team to let the Hawks come back from 3-1.  This makes this game even more important. Hawks coach Joel Quenneville has been mum about changes, but we do know of one: Adam Burish will be in the lineup after missing the first game in the series. Burish in the lineup will boost the team.
